Output 634c366fbc91872c042ed34ae22410d5d6f7ca2c71ae2839e2f60511b8af3bd0:0

value
2860423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af557856b74229ec47457d35cb142933e0f62ee OP_EQUAL
address
MEjW9H6PNfkNiu9Qxsw4PS5iJryJ2JvBSA
transaction
634c366fbc91872c042ed34ae22410d5d6f7ca2c71ae2839e2f60511b8af3bd0
spent
true